In her floral interpretation of Hester Finch’s Nude on Orange with Purple Ground, Harriet Parry responds not only to the painting’s striking palette but also to its psychological depth. Finch’s nude, rendered in poised yet vulnerable repose, is framed by saturated blocks of orange and violet—colours that radiate both heat and introspection. Parry’s arrangement echoes this chromatic tension through the careful selection of blooms in warm, fiery tones offset by rich purples and deep greens.
The flowers are not simply decorative; they act as a spatial and emotional echo of the figure’s internal world—structured yet soft, exposed yet composed. By translating Finch’s exploration of the female body and its presence in space into living material, Parry engages in a parallel act of composition—one that honours the quiet strength and layered complexity at the heart of Finch’s work.

Harriet Parry is a London-based floral artist whose intuitive botanical installations and spellbinding floral interpretations blur the line between art and enchantment. Her work doesn’t simply invite admiration—it transports you to a world where flora and fauna reign supreme and beauty is the ruling force.
